trans-4-Bromocinnamaldehyde
Based on 1 Customer Validation
trans-4-Bromocinnamaldehyde (Compound 6d) is an (E)-α,β-unsaturated aldehyde and cinnamaldehyde derivative. trans-4-Bromocinnamaldehyde serves as a starting material for the synthesis of α-aryl substituted phosphinomycin analogs. trans-4-Bromocinnamaldehyde can be used in the research of tuberculosis.

References
[1]. Nordqvist A, et al. Synthesis of functionalized cinnamaldehyde derivatives by an oxidative Heck reaction and their use as starting materials for preparation of Mycobacterium tuberculosis 1-deoxy-D-xylulose-5-phosphate reductoisomerase inhibitors. J Org Chem. 2011;76(21):8986-8998. [Content Brief]
